Designer Notes You’ll Actually Use

Before committing Cross Risen Christian Matthew PNG to a client deliverable, run these checks:

  1. Test in black and white—verify all key shapes retain definition without color cues;
  2. Preview on both light and dark backgrounds—confirm contrast meets WCAG AA standards for accessibility;
  3. Scale it down to 1.25” and up to 24”—look for pixelation, stroke collapse, or kerning issues in the “Matthew” lettering;
  4. Drop it into real product mockups—not just flat previews—to assess proportion and emotional impact;
  5. Run a test print on your intended substrate (e.g., Bella+Canvas 3001, Cricut Everyday Iron-On);
  6. Inspect the PNG transparency—ensure no stray pixels or anti-aliasing halos around edges;
  7. If an SVG version is included, open it in Illustrator—check for grouped layers, editable paths, and unexpanded text;
  8. Compare font pairings—try it beside script fonts (for contrast), serif fonts (for gravitas), and handwritten fonts (for approachability);
  9. Verify commercial license terms—confirm it permits use in client-facing work, resale items (Etsy, Redbubble), and print-on-demand platforms.
